Wichita State University (KS) - Distinguished Visiting Writer-in-Residence, One Month Appointment

Wichita State University (Kansas, United States)

One-month, in-person visiting position for a fiction writer to teach a tutorial course to approximately 15 graduate and advanced undergraduate fiction writing students during the Fall 2024 or Spring 2025 semester and to give one in-person reading while in residence. Qualifications: extensive high-quality publications in top national journals and magazines and at least one high-quality novel or story collection; awards, fellowships, and a national reputation preferred. Salary is $18,000 for the month.

Wichita State University (KS) – Emerging Visiting Poet-in-Residence, One Month Appointment

Wichita State University (Kansas, United States)

One-month, in-person position for an emerging poet to teach a tutorial course to approximately 15 graduate and advanced undergraduate poetry writing students during the Fall 2024 or Spring 2025 semester and to give one in-person reading while in residence. Qualifications: high-quality publications in top national journals and/or one high-quality poetry collection with a notable press; successful teaching experience; awards and fellowships preferred. Salary is $5,000 for the month.
